Unlocking Biological Insights with Custom Peptide Synthesis

Custom peptide synthesis has revolutionized biological research by providing scientists with the ability to design and produce peptides with unprecedented specificity. These synthetic peptides serve as valuable tools for a wide range of applications, from elucidating molecular processes to developing novel therapeutics. By altering the amino acid sequence of peptides, researchers can create molecules with specific functions and properties, enabling them to investigate complex biological systems at a primary level.

The versatility of custom peptide synthesis is evident in its diverse applications across various fields of biology. In drug discovery, synthetic peptides can be used as drug candidates for targeting specific proteins. In diagnostics, they serve as sensitive and specific probes for detecting diagnostic targets. Furthermore, custom peptides play a crucial role in understanding fundamental biological processes, such as cell signaling, protein interactions, and immune responses.

Ultimately, the ability to synthesize peptides with tailor-made properties has augmented researchers to delve deeper into the intricacies of life, unlocking new understandings that pave the way for advancements in medicine, biotechnology, and our overall comprehension of the living world.

Delving into Top Peptide Synthesis Companies: A Comprehensive Guide

Peptides are biomolecules gaining increasing traction in research and pharmaceutical applications. The intricate process of peptide synthesis demands specialized expertise and advanced technologies. To explore the extensive landscape of peptide synthesis companies, consider these key factors:

  • Reputation in the industry is paramount, with established companies demonstrating a history of reliable results.
  • Customization options are crucial for addressing specific research or clinical needs.
  • Technical Expertise in various peptide synthesis methods, including solid-phase and solution-phase synthesis, is essential.

Thorough analysis of potential manufacturers will enable your selection of the most ideal partner for your peptide synthesis needs.

Navigating the World of Protein Synthesis Services

Delving into the realm of peptide synthesis can be a complex and often daunting task. With a myriad of choices available, researchers and developers alike may find themselves overwhelmed by the sheer amount of laboratories. To successfully navigate this intricate landscape, it is crucial to understand the fundamental principles underlying peptide synthesis and carefully evaluate the diverse range of services available.

A comprehensive understanding of your specific research needs is paramount when choosing a suitable peptide synthesis service. Factors such as the desired peptide sequence, purity level, scale of production, and budget will all determine the optimal choice for your project.

Furthermore, it is essential to evaluate the reputation and credentials of the chosen provider. Seeking out established companies with a proven track record of success can reduce the risk of encountering production challenges.
